Comparing Routine and Emergency Plumber Calls in Northwich
Whether you're dealing with a slow drip or a burst pipe in Northwich, knowing which type of plumber visit you actually need helps you plan and budget properly. Planned plumbing appointments are for non-urgent tasks such as installing shower pumps, swapping out valves, or upgrading taps. Urgent call-outs are for active leaks, serious blockages, and anything that risks damage to your home if left even a few hours.

How Urgent Does a Plumbing Problem Have to Be?
Emergency plumbing situations are ones where waiting even a few hours could cause costly problems to your home. A genuine plumbing emergency usually involves an active leak that's putting your home, belongings, or health at risk. Knowing when to call an emergency plumber near Northwich, rather than booking a routine slot, can make a real difference to the outcome. Common emergencies include a pipe that's burst . Sudden, uncontrolled leaks, severe blockages, and situations where water is actively going where it shouldn't all warrant an same-day plumber visit . If water is causing visible damage, that's an emergency, not a job to add to next week's list.
